Financial Performance - The company's revenue for Q1 2025 reached ¥1,153,173,502.80, representing a 24.22% increase compared to ¥928,362,079.14 in the same period last year[5] - Net profit attributable to shareholders surged to ¥119,043,768.94, a remarkable increase of 488.44% from ¥20,230,315.08 year-on-year[5] -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was ¥42,468,989.71, up 399.70% from ¥8,498,826.59 in the previous year[5] - Basic and diluted earnings per share both increased to ¥0.04, reflecting a 300.00% rise compared to ¥0.01 in the same period last year[5] - Total operating revenue for the current period reached ¥1,155,131,570.30, an increase of approximately 24.1% compared to ¥930,807,607.00 in the previous period[20] - Operating profit for the current period was ¥130,119,194.60, significantly up from ¥37,546,061.73 in the previous period, marking an increase of approximately 245.5%[20] - Net profit attributable to the parent company was ¥119,043,768.94, compared to ¥20,230,315.08 in the previous period, reflecting an increase of approximately 487.5%[21] - The total comprehensive income for the current period was ¥124,806,039.64, compared to ¥21,870,325.97 in the previous period, an increase of approximately 471.5%[21] - The company recorded a significant increase in investment income, reaching ¥69,594,801.18 compared to ¥2,577,823.78 in the previous period, marking an increase of approximately 2590.5%[20] Cash Flow - Cash flow from operating activities decreased by 29.23% to ¥129,565,205.37, down from ¥183,070,330.30 in the same quarter last year[11] - The net cash flow from operating activities was ¥129,565,205.37, down from ¥183,070,330.30 in the previous period, indicating a decrease of approximately 29.2%[22] - The total cash inflow from operating activities was ¥1,747,420,428.62, compared to ¥1,496,362,207.29 in the previous period, an increase of approximately 16.8%[22] - Cash outflow from investment activities totaled $129,264,700, significantly up from $43,633,177 in the previous period, marking an increase of approximately 195%[23] - Net cash flow from investment activities was -$104,785,868.42, worsening from -$32,655,807.72 year-over-year[23] - Cash outflow from financing activities amounted to $56,173,104.10, down from $132,513,014.61, indicating a decrease of about 58.6%[23] - Net cash flow from financing activities was -$56,173,104.10, compared to -$108,532,152.49 in the prior period[23] - The net increase in cash and cash equivalents was -$31,393,767.15, contrasting with a positive increase of $41,882,370.09 in the previous period[23] - The ending balance of cash and cash equivalents stood at $971,290,200.01, up from $541,081,575.58 year-over-year[23] Assets and Liabilities - The company's total assets slightly decreased by 0.12% to ¥22,101,816,178.75 from ¥22,129,133,901.52 at the end of the previous year[5] - Total current assets decreased from 1,970,095,952.45 CNY to 1,898,251,604.23 CNY, a decline of approximately 3.65%[17] - Inventory decreased from 325,168,201.37 CNY to 253,534,718.70 CNY, a reduction of about 22.05%[17] - Total current liabilities decreased from 2,273,634,291.95 CNY to 2,142,377,214.75 CNY, a decline of about 5.78%[18] - The company reported a decrease in accounts payable from 772,504,266.05 CNY to 596,947,480.01 CNY, a reduction of approximately 22.73%[18] - Non-current assets increased from 20,159,037,949.07 CNY to 20,203,564,574.52 CNY, an increase of about 0.22%[18] - Total liabilities decreased to ¥13,724,799,407.09 from ¥13,910,956,215.84, a reduction of approximately 1.3%[19] - Total equity attributable to shareholders increased to ¥8,022,482,200.13 from ¥7,869,179,872.68, an increase of approximately 1.9%[19] Shareholder Information - Total number of common shareholders at the end of the reporting period is 45,024[13] - The largest shareholder, Bubu Gao Commercial Chain Co., Ltd., holds 11.14% of shares, totaling 299,508,188 shares[14] - The second-largest shareholder, Bubu Gao Investment Group Co., Ltd., holds 7.19% of shares, totaling 193,297,635 shares, with 187,173,300 shares pledged[13] Operational Strategy - The company has focused on optimizing resource allocation by closing underperforming stores and concentrating on high-quality outlets, which has improved overall operational efficiency[10] - The company has not disclosed any new product developments or market expansion strategies in the current report[15] Governance and Compliance - The company did not undergo an audit for the first quarter report[24] - The new accounting standards will be first implemented starting in 2025[24] - The company’s board meeting was held on April 22, 2025[25]
